Default William Lowe, the 'father of the IBM PC,' dies at 72

For some reason the news went unnoticed.

From http://news.cnet.com/8301-10797_3-57...pc-dies-at-72/
Quote:
After his proposal for a quick market entry via Atari was rejected, Lowe was given one year to design and produce a personal computer that would be market-ready.
